Overview of the L1 Visa





The L1 visa is a non-immigrant category that enables companies to move staff members from consular services to their U.S. branches, subsidiaries, or associates. This visa category is especially useful for international firms seeking to leverage their international skill pool by transferring essential employees to boost procedures in the United States. The L1 visa is split right into two key subcategories: L1A for managers and execs, and L1B for employees with specialized knowledge, each dealing with various organizational needs.The L1 visa facilitates the smooth activity of qualified staff members, thus cultivating worldwide company development and functional effectiveness. With the L1A visa, business can move individuals who hold supervisory or executive roles, enabling them to make strategic decisions and look after specific departments within the U. L1 Visa.S. entity. Alternatively, the L1B visa is developed for employees having specialized expertise crucial to the business's interests, guaranteeing that the U.S. office take advantage of unique skills and expertise.One notable benefit of the L1 visa is its double intent nature, which allows owners to make an application for permanent residency while maintaining their non-immigrant status. In addition, spouses and youngsters of L1 visa owners can accompany them to the USA under the L2 visa classification, which likewise permits work consent


Kinds of L1 Visas



Multiple kinds of L1 visas deal with the diverse demands of multinational firms wanting to transfer employees to the USA. Both primary categories of L1 visas are L1A and L1B, each developed for details duties and duties within an organization.The L1A visa is intended for supervisors and executives. This group allows firms to transfer people who hold supervisory or executive positions, enabling them to supervise procedures in the U.S. This visa is legitimate for a first duration of as much as 3 years, with the opportunity of extensions for a total amount of up to seven years. The L1A visa is especially useful for firms looking for to establish a strong leadership existence in the U.S. market.On the various other hand, the L1B visa is assigned for employees with specialized expertise. This consists of individuals that possess innovative expertise in specific areas, such as exclusive innovations or unique procedures within the company. The L1B visa is also valid for a preliminary three-year duration, with expansions offered for approximately 5 years. This visa classification is optimal for firms that require employees with specialized skills to enhance their procedures and preserve a competitive edge in the U. Qualification Needs



To receive an L1 visa, both the employer and the employee must fulfill details qualification requirements established by united state migration authorities. The L1 visa is developed for intra-company transferees, enabling international companies to transfer staff members to their U.S. offices.First, the employer has to be a certifying organization, which means it must have a moms and dad firm, branch, subsidiary, or associate that is doing business both in the united state and in the foreign nation. This connection is important for demonstrating that the employee is being transferred within the same company structure. The employer must additionally have actually been doing organization for at least one year in both locations.Second, the employee should have been used by the international firm for a minimum of one continuous year within the 3 years preceding the application. This work has to be in a managerial, exec, or specialized expertise ability. For L1A visas, which deal with supervisors and executives, the staff member must demonstrate that they will remain to run in a comparable capacity in the U.S. For L1B visas, meant for workers with specialized expertise, the specific need to possess distinct experience that adds considerably to the business's procedures.


Application Process



Maneuvering the application procedure for an L1 visa includes numerous vital steps that should be completed accurately to guarantee an effective outcome. The very first step is to identify the ideal classification of the L1 visa: L1A for supervisors and executives, or L1B for workers with specialized knowledge (L1 Visa). This difference is substantial, as it influences the documentation required.Once the classification is identified, the united state company should file Kind I-129, Application for a Nonimmigrant Employee. This type needs to include detailed information concerning the firm, the worker's function, and the nature of the work to be executed in the united state Accompanying documents typically includes proof of the relationship between the united state and foreign entities, proof of the employee's certifications, and info pertaining to the job offer.After entry, the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) will assess the request. If accepted, the employee will certainly be informed, and they can after that obtain the visa at an U.S. consular office or consular office in their home nation. This entails completing Type DS-160, the Online Nonimmigrant copyright, and arranging an interview.During the interview, the applicant needs to offer various files, including the authorized Type I-129, evidence of employment, and any kind of extra supporting proof. Following the interview, if the visa is given, the worker will get a visa stamp in their key, allowing them to enter the U.S. to benefit the funding company. Correct prep work and thorough documents are essential to steering this process properly

Usual Obstacles



While the L1 visa provides numerous advantages for international companies and their staff members, it is not without its obstacles. One notable obstacle is the strict documents and qualification needs imposed by the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) Business must give detailed proof of the international employee's qualifications, the nature of business, and the certifying relationship between the U.S. and foreign entities. This procedure can be taxing and might call for lawful proficiency to browse successfully.Another challenge is the potential for scrutiny during the petition process. USCIS police officers might examine the authenticity of business procedures or the staff member's role within the company. This scrutiny can cause delays or also rejections of the copyright, which can greatly affect the company's functional strategies and the staff member's occupation trajectory.Furthermore, the L1 visa is tied to the sponsoring employer, which means that work changes can complicate the visa condition. If an L1 visa owner desires to switch over companies, they must commonly seek a different visa category, which can include intricacy to their immigration journey.Lastly, maintaining compliance with L1 visa guidelines is important. Employers have to ensure that their worker's role lines up with the first request and that the service proceeds to satisfy the qualification needs. Failing to do so can cause abrogation of the visa, affecting both the staff member and the company. These challenges necessitate extensive prep work and recurring management to assure an effective L1 visa experience.

Can Family Members Accompany L1 Visa Holders?



Yes, family members can come with L1 visa holders. Spouses and single youngsters under 21 years of ages are eligible for L2 visas, which permit them to live and examine in the United States throughout the L1 owner's stay.




For How Long Can L1 Visa Holders Stay in the united state?



L1 visa holders can at first stay in the U (L1 Visa).S. for as much as 3 years. This duration may be extended, enabling an optimum stay of seven years for L1A visa owners and 5 years for L1B visa owners


Is the L1 Visa a Twin Intent Visa?



The L1 visa is thought about a double intent visa, allowing owners to seek permanent residency while preserving their short-lived non-immigrant status. This flexibility facilitates lasting career opportunities for international staff members within united state firms.
